127. Deputy Finian McGrath asked the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ine the steps he is taking to ensure that the Annelles Ilena, the largest fishing vessel in the world, and the Margiris, the second largest fishing vessel in the world, are in compliance with the rules of the Common Fisheries Policy, and if independent observers are on board the two vessels;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[42188/15]
